Downloading a Data File
To download a file under normal data-logging operations, you would do the
following:
• Open the Environmental Enclosure.
• Discontinue sampling.
• Attach the supplied RJ45 to the RS-232 cable from the D
USTTRAK
monitor to a notebook computer.
• Download the data file using T
RAKPRO software (refer to Chapter 2 of
this manual for further details).
Real-Time Monitoring
The Environmental Enclosure comes equipped with an external DB9
connector. This allows the D
USTTRAK monitor to be connected to a
computer for continuous real-time monitoring. To set up the Environmental
Enclosure for real-time monitoring follow these instructions:
• Connect the D
USTTRAK monitor to the DB9 connector, which is
mounted on the inside of the enclosure, using the Computer Interface
Cable provided with the D
USTTRAK monitor.
• Attach a standard 9-pin serial cable (not supplied) from the DB9
connector on the outside of the enclosure to a computer serial port. The
computer can be configured to query the D
USTTRAK monitor when in a
terminal emulator mode. See Application Note ITI-044 for more
information on these commands.
